#2d2ed2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d2ed2 is composed of 17.6% red, 18%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 239.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 50%. #2d2ed2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a5cff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2d2ed2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2d2ed2 has RGB values of R:45, G:46,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2961106.

Shades and Tints of #2d2ed2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030410 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d2ed2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7c84 is the less saturated color, while #0607f9 is the most saturated one.
